How do you use Hhfudic cream?

When using Hhfudic Cream it is important to apply it in a thin layer that adequately covers the affected areas This cream is typically used on the skin two to three times a day focusing on the areas that require treatment After using Hhfudic Cream it is recommended to wash your hands thoroughly unless you are specifically using it to address a skin infection on your hands By following these guidelines you can ensure the proper application and effective use of Hhfudic Cream to promote optimal results Remember to adhere to the recommended dosage and frequency as directed by your healthcare professional Regular and consistent use of this cream can help alleviate symptoms and promote healing It is always best to consult with a medical professional for personalized advice and guidance when using any medication
